常见集合与应用 作业5-2

来源:5-2 编程练习

rudtjd

2023-02-02 16:52:02

import java.util.ArrayList;
import java.util.Collection;
import java.util.Collections;
import java.util.List;

public class StringSort {
    public static void main(String[] args) {

            //给list添加元素
            List<String> list = new ArrayList<>();

            //输出排序前list中的内容
            list.add("orange");
            list.add("tomato");
            list.add("apple");
            list.add("litchi");
            list.add("banana");
            System.out.println("排序前:");
            System.out.println(list);

            //对list中的元素进行排序
            //输出排序后list中的内容
            Collections.sort(list);
            System.out.println("排序后:");
            for(String s:list){
                System.out.print(s+" ");
            }
    }
}


https://img.mukewang.com/climg/63db799609885adb04730136.jpg

老师 运行结果有些不相似 请问上面那行 代码需要怎么改

写回答

1回答

好帮手慕小蓝

2023-02-02

同学你好,输出的第一行与题目不同是因为同学直接打印了集合。如果此处也使用下面的方式,用循环去遍历输出,就没有这个方括号了。

祝学习愉快~

0

0 学习 · 9886 问题

查看课程